📄 new.php
字号:
<?php
include_once( "inc/auth.php" );
include_once( "inc/reg_func.php" );
echo "\r\n<html>\r\n<head>\r\n<title>菜单新建</title>\r\n<meta http-equiv=\"Content-Type\" content=\"text/html; charset=gb2312\">\r\n\r\n<script Language=\"JavaScript\">\r\nfunction CheckForm()\r\n{\r\n if(document.form1.FUNC_ID1.value==\"\")\r\n { alert(\"子菜单项ID不能为空!\");\r\n return (false);\r\n }\r\n\r\n if(document.form1.FUNC_NAME.value==\"\")\r\n { alert(\"子菜单名称不能为空!\");\r\n return (false);\r\n }\r\n\r\n if(document.form1.MENU_ID.value.length!=4 && document.form1.MENU_ID.value.length!=6 && document.form1.MENU_ID.value.length!=8)\r\n { alert(\"菜单项代码应为4位或6位数字或8位数字!\");\r\n return (false);\r\n }\r\n}\r\n</script>\r\n</head>\r\n\r\n";
$connection = openconnection( );
$query = "SELECT max(FUNC_ID) from SYS_FUNCTION where FUNC_ID<1000";
$cursor = exequery( $connection, $query );
if ( $ROW = mysql_fetch_array( $cursor ) )
{
$FUNC_ID_MAX1 = $ROW[0];
}
$query = "SELECT max(func_id) from SYS_FUNCTION where FUNC_ID>1000";
$cursor = exequery( $connection, $query );
if ( $ROW = mysql_fetch_array( $cursor ) )
{
$FUNC_ID_MAX2 = $ROW[0];
}
if ( $FUNC_ID_MAX2 == 0 )
{
$FUNC_ID_MAX2 = 1000;
}
echo "\r\n<body class=\"bodycolor\" topmargin=\"5\" onload=\"document.form1.MENU_ID.focus();\">\r\n<table border=\"0\" width=\"100%\" cellspacing=\"0\" cellpadding=\"3\" class=\"small\">\r\n <tr>\r\n <td class=\"Big\"><img src=\"/images/edit.gif\" WIDTH=\"22\" HEIGHT=\"20\" align=\"absmiddle\"><span class=\"big3\"> 新建子菜单项</span>\r\n </td>\r\n </tr>\r\n</table>\r\n\r\n";
message( "", "目前子菜单项ID<br>1000以内最大为".$FUNC_ID_MAX1."<br>1000以上最大为{$FUNC_ID_MAX2}" );
echo "\r\n<br>\r\n<table border=\"0\" cellspacing=\"1\" width=\"450\" class=\"small\" bgcolor=\"#000000\" cellpadding=\"3\" align=\"center\" >\r\n <form action=\"insert.php\" method=\"post\" name=\"form1\" onsubmit=\"return CheckForm();\">\r\n <tr>\r\n <td nowrap class=\"TableData\" width=\"120\">子菜单项ID:</td>\r\n <td nowrap class=\"TableData\">\r\n <input type=\"text\" name=\"FUNC_ID1\" class=\"BigInput\" size=\"20\" maxlength=\"50\" value=\"";
echo $FUNC_ID_MAX2 + 1;
echo "\"><br>\r\n 说明:用户添加的菜单项ID建议大于1000,1000以内为系统保留\r\n </td>\r\n </tr>\r\n <tr>\r\n <td nowrap class=\"TableData\" width=\"120\">子菜单项代码:</td>\r\n <td nowrap class=\"TableData\">\r\n <input type=\"text\" name=\"MENU_ID\" class=\"BigInput\" size=\"20\" maxlength=\"50\" value=\"";
echo $MENU_ID;
echo "\"><br>\r\n 说明:此代码共分4段,每两位代表一级菜单,为4位或6位或8位数字\r\n </td>\r\n </tr>\r\n <tr>\r\n <td nowrap class=\"TableData\">子菜单名称:</td>\r\n <td nowrap class=\"TableData\">\r\n <input type=\"text\" name=\"FUNC_NAME\" class=\"BigInput\" size=\"20\" maxlength=\"50\" value=\"\"> \r\n </td>\r\n </tr>\r\n <tr>\r\n <td nowrap class=\"TableData\">子菜单模块路径:</td>\r\n <td nowrap class=\"TableData\">\r\n <input type=\"text\" name=\"FUNC_CODE1\" class=\"BigInput\" size=\"40\" value=\"\">\r\n </td>\r\n </tr>\r\n <tr>\r\n <td class=\"TableData\" colspan=2>\r\n <b>子菜单模块路径定义方式,应根据此菜单项的类型决定</b>:<br><br>\r\n <b>类型一</b>:如果此菜单下仍存在下级菜单,则填写@英文名称,格式如:@mail,对应的图片是:OA安装目录/webroot/images/menu/@mail.gif<br>\r\n <br>\r\n <b>类型二</b>:如果此菜单是挂接OA系统中的模块,则填写程序路径,格式如:email,则实际对应的路径是:OA安装目录/webroot/general/email,对应的图片是:OA安装目录/webroot/images/menu/email.gif<br>\r\n <br>\r\n <b>类型三</b>:如果此菜单是挂接外部的B/S结构的系统,则填写该系统网址,格式如:http://";
echo $TD_MYOA_WEB_SITE;
echo ",注意:请一定要以http://开头<br>\r\n <br>\r\n <b>类型四</b>:如果此菜单是挂接外部的C/S结构或单机版系统,则填写可执行文件路径,格式如:file://c:/abc.exe,注意:请一定要以file://开头,后面的程序路径用斜杠或反斜杠均可\r\n </td>\r\n </tr>\r\n <tr>\r\n <td nowrap class=\"TableControl\" colspan=\"2\" align=\"center\">\r\n <input type=\"submit\" value=\"确定\" class=\"BigButton\"> \r\n <input type=\"button\" value=\"返回\" class=\"BigButton\" onclick=\"history.back();\">\r\n </td>\r\n </form>\r\n</table>\r\n\r\n</body>\r\n</html>";
?>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-